Located on Yahatacho in Soka, "敬" is a restaurant that offers an array of Korean dishes. Known for its flavorful but not overly spicy cuisine, the menu features specialties like slow-cooked collagen stew, which is appreciated by patrons for its tender texture. While their beer, small plates, and other alcoholic offerings add to the dining experience, takeaway and dine-in are the available service options, though delivery isn't offered.
Despite receiving favorable comments from visitors, there hasn't been much recent feedback, with the last review surfacing a year ago. The restaurant operates from Tuesday to Sunday, opening its doors at 5 PM and serving until midnight. Those planning a visit might want to note the absence of wheelchair accessibility and consider calling ahead as reservations are accepted.
